Abstract

Vocational School (SMK) was established to create and produce graduates who have special skills. Graduates are expected to 'ready to enter the 'world of work' as market demands. However, in reality, there are many vocational school graduates who have not been able to enter the world of work. The purpose of this study was to analyze the effect of the economic growth of primary sector, secondary sector, tertiary sector, and the wage rate to the provision of employment for graduates of vocational schools. This study uses secondary data consisting of the data during the period 2010- 2012 times series and cross section data of 35 districts / cities in Central Java. Data were collected from secondary sources, namely: Central Bureau of Statistics (BPS) Central Java, and the Department of Manpower and Transmigration Central Java. The analysis used panel data analysis approach LSDV (Least Square Dummy Variable). The ability of the model in explaining the variation of dependent variable by 51.7% while the remaining 48.3% is explained by other factors outside the model. Regression results indicate that only partial tertiary sector economic growth variables were significant variables affecting the employment of graduates of vocational schools. This can be caused by economic growth in the tertiary sector, which is higher than the primary sector and the secondary sector. Economic conditions of a region will reflect the increased production of high activity. Increased production capacity of the tertiary sector will require high production factors, including labor. So many companies are adding new workers and will ultimately increase their job opportunities.
